Usage Examples
This section provides practical, ready-to-use examples for implementing search functionality in your frontend applications. Copy and adapt these examples for your specific needs.
Quick Reference
Basic Filtering - Simple search operations
Advanced Filtering - Complex multi-field queries
Pagination & Sorting - Data organization
Complex Queries - Real-world business scenarios
Example Categories
🔍 Basic Filtering
Simple, single-field search operations that form the foundation of your search functionality.
🎯 Advanced Filtering
Multi-field queries that combine different operations for precise data filtering.
📄 Pagination & Sorting
Essential techniques for handling large datasets and organizing results.
🧠 Complex Queries
Real-world business scenarios that combine multiple concepts for powerful data insights.
How to Use These Examples
Copy the HTTP examples - Use these directly in your API testing tools
Adapt the JavaScript code - Integrate the code snippets into your frontend
Modify field names - Replace example fields with your actual requirements
Combine concepts - Mix and match different patterns for your use cases
Tools for Testing
API Testing
Postman: Import the HTTP examples
cURL: Convert examples to command line
Browser: Use directly in address bar for GET requests
Frontend Integration
JavaScript/TypeScript: Use the provided utility functions
React: Adapt the custom hooks
Any Framework: The concepts work universally
Ready to start? Begin with Basic Filtering for simple examples, or jump to Complex Queries for advanced scenarios!